Accident Summary Nr: 202352605 - Two Untrained Workers Burned in Arc Flash

Abstract: Two technicians were called to service malfunctioning air compressors. Employee #1 went to a circuit breaker and tested the line side of the breaker with a lead and alligator clip. The alligator clip contacted the side of the breaker causing an electrical fault. The ensuing arc burned both employees on their faces and hands. Neither employee was using personal protective equipment. Employee #1 was not qualified to work on electric equipment, and the clip used was uninsulated.
